Solar and wind plant were sometimes unable to generate into the grid, but that was because the nuclear was already providing the requisite demand!
You
could, technically
, reduce power from the nuclear stations if you wanted to. The issue is that it is economically pointless to do so.
The marginal cost of running a nuclear power plant you already have is essentially zero.
Reducing output is economically equivalent to turning on a bunch of fan heaters outside the station.
The curtailed electricity generation has a marginal value of zero, since they could no find anyone to sell it to. I'd suggest a far more sensible solution to this problem is to install grid controlled heating loads for
hot water or industry, which would allow that surplus electricity to at least displace gas. Not order the elimination of several gigawatts of proven very low carbon generating plant.
On electricity prices, Germany has the
second highest electricity price in the EU, after only Ireland. They are double what they are in France.
And, finally, as of 1AM (London Time) 23/06/2024, Germany is pulling 7.5GW of French electricity across the border, French electricity that is currently overwhelmingly nuclear.
German progress is underwritten by French, Czech and Swedish nuclear and in being able to offload piles of surplus electricity to the rest of Europe. As decarbonisation progresses this strategy will become less and less tenable because there will be increasingly no fossil plant to displace.
